When the goal is a setup that a single person can realistically carry and use, the most achievable solutions are portable or handheld ultrasound units and compact DR X-ray equipment. Modern handheld ultrasound units can be small enough to fit in one hand or a backpack, have very low weight, and work by connecting to common mobile or desktop devices.

Results can be sent right away to hospital PACS or remote servers over Wi-Fi or mobile data, making them well-suited for one-person field deployment or bedside imaging. This is the most "backpack-level" imaging modality available today, and is already widely used in mobile and point-of-care settings.

Mobile DR X-ray is usable even in one-person field operations, but it is less "handheld" than ultrasound. A typical setup includes a mobile X-ray head together with a wireless digital detector. It can be carried and operated by one qualified individual, but it still involves radiation safety controls, operator licensing rules, required shielding methods, and government oversight and approval.

Images are acquired in digital format and uploaded to a central server or radiology workstation. While portable, it is never considered a do-it-yourself device because of legal radiation controls. These require large, fixed infrastructure, high power demands, shielding, cooling systems, and strict facility licensing. No current technology allows these to be safely or legally operated by one person in a mobile, carry-in format.

In most real-world cases, no—tablet-sized scanners cannot reliably replace X-ray for confirming broken bones, especially in accidents. Here’s the clear breakdown.

X-rays remain the top choice for confirming bone fractures in clinical settings. Actual portable X-ray machines are produced by several manufacturers, but they are still far bulkier than any tablet. Even the most minimized portable X-ray solutions that meet regulations require: a portable X-ray head, often placed on a mini-cart, a flat-panel imaging detector, comprehensive radiation safety procedures along with legal licensing requirements.

While one trained technologist can operate these units, they are not handheld or backpack-portable, and they must follow strict radiation regulations. There is currently no tablet-only device that can emit diagnostic X-rays safely and legally. What tablet-sized or handheld devices cando is ultrasound, and ultrasound can sometimesdetect certain fractures. In emergency or accident scenarios, point-of-care ultrasound (POCUS) may identify:obvious cortical disruptions, joint effusions suggesting fractures, pediatric fractures (children’s bones are more ultrasound-visible), rib, clavicle, and some long-bone fractures.

However, ultrasound cannot fully replace X-ray because: it is operator-dependent, it cannot visualize complex or deep bone structures well, it may miss hairline or non-displaced fractures, it is not accepted as definitive imaging for most medico-legal or orthopedic decisions. So in an accident scenario, a tablet-sized ultrasound device can be used as a rapid screening tool, especially in remote or emergency settings, but confirmation still requires X-ray once proper imaging is available.
